
About this episode
After 26 years, the Richmond Night Market is set to close after its 2026 season. The news raises questions for businesses and city officials who saw it as an important meeting place that brought families, cultures and flavours together. So - what is Richmond really losing? What comes next? And how might this influence the upcoming municipal election? Jason D'Souza and Justin McElroy examine the big questions.
